One of the most profound shifts in the breaking news landscape has actually been the rise of citizen journalism. In the age of mobile phones, anyone can record a newsworthy moment and share it with the world. Whether it's footage of police misbehavior, a viral video of a natural disaster, or a tweet about a regional protest, resident reports have actually often provided the first glimpse into unfolding events.
This democratization of news has both empowered the general public and developed brand-new obstacles. On one hand, it decreases media gatekeeping and brings worldwide attention to occasions that may otherwise be disregarded. On the other hand, it increases the spread of false information, especially when raw footage is gotten of context or become misguide viewers.
News platforms now stroll a tightrope: how to integrate citizen-sourced material into their reporting while guaranteeing its credibility. Leading outlets have established extensive protocols for confirming such material, and lots of now work together with open-source intelligence (OSINT) experts who concentrate on geolocation, metadata analysis, and reverse image searches.

The Emotional Impact of Breaking News
Breaking news doesn't simply notify-- it moves people. The emotional weight of a headline can ripple through societies, altering habits, sparking protests, or providing solace. A story about a humanitarian crisis may activate global help; news of a terrible school shooting might trigger public outcry and legal modification.
The psychological effects of breaking news are particularly apparent in the age of digital media. Consistent notifies, push notices, and real-time updates can result in stress and anxiety, emotional tiredness, and even a phenomenon referred to as "doomscrolling." Studies have shown that duplicated exposure to terrible news can cause stress responses similar to those experienced in direct injury.
This raises essential ethical questions about the responsibility of news Find out more outlets in delivering content. Should there be cautions before revealing graphic material? How should headlines be crafted to notify without sensationalizing?

How Breaking News Shapes Global Narratives
The way a breaking story is framed can affect global relations, shape public understanding, and even modify the course of history. When a major event occurs, such as a military coup, a stock exchange crash, or an advancement in environment science, the initial protection can either enhance stereotypes or challenge them, promote peace or escalate stress.
Western and non-Western media often depict the same story in significantly various lights. For instance, a demonstration in one country might be labeled a "civil uprising" by some outlets and a "terrorist danger" by others. These variations are not merely semantic; they reflect cultural predispositions, political interests, and historic contexts.
This is why media literacy has ended up being a vital skill in the modern world. Audiences need to learn to determine predisposition, cross-reference sources, and comprehend that no report is totally neutral.
